Depart the pier with your guide for the scenic, approximately 1.5-hour drive to the Sibuya Private Game Reserve. One of South Africa's most unique safari destinations, Sibuya has more navigable rivers than any other game reserve in South Africa. As a result, it is home to nearly 400 different bird species and one of the most renowned birding destinations in the region. This breathtakingly beautiful game reserve is also a sanctuary to an abundance of diverse wildlife, from elephants to otters and almost everything in between, including the Big Five (lions, leopards, elephants, rhinos, and buffaloes).

Sibuya offers accommodation in two private and exclusive, luxury-tented game lodges, and prides itself on superb cuisine. Thought to be amongst South Africa's most beautiful private game reserves, Sibuya spans more than 7,413 acres (about 3,000 hectares) of varied terrain and vegetation. From the moderately-open river plains and through the pristine Lower Albany thicket, there are also patches of Cape fynbos and a windswept, grassy plateau favoured by many of the larger grazing animals. Sibuya supports one of the highest densities of wildlife in South Africa, ensuring an intensive and varied game-viewing experience amidst spectacular natural surrounds.

Sibuya's reception area is located in the holiday village of Kenton-on-Sea, in the eastern Cape Province. Upon arrival and after welcome drinks and a comfort stop, proceed to the river and embark your awaiting boat for the approximately 45-minute cruise to the Forest Camp. Upon arrival, disembark the boat, receive your safety and tour instructions, then board your open-air, 4WD safari vehicle for an approximately three-hour game drive through the Sibuya Game Reserve. Afterward, proceed to the Day Centre at Forest Camp for a buffet lunch. After lunch, embark your boat for the approximately 45-minute river cruise back to the reception area, then re-board your coach and commence the approximately 1.5-hour drive back to the pier.
